Cost by material in Providence
Installed Providence pricing per unit.
| Option | Installed cost |
|---|---|
| 1/3 HP pedestal | $1,100 – $1,550 |
| 1/2 HP submersible | $1,550 – $2,000 |
| Submersible with battery backup | $2,000 – $2,600 |
| Dual pump with water-powered backup | $2,600 – $3,600 |

Ways to save in Providence
- Install backup power — most failures happen during storm outages.
- Replace preventively at year 8 instead of after a flood.
- Collect three written bids on an identical scope — spreads of 20–40% are normal.
- Book in the off-season and stay flexible on the start date to save 5–15%.
- Bundle nearby work into one mobilization so you only pay setup and travel once.
- Ask what the contractor would change to cut 10% without hurting durability.
